One of the first things to try when your connection doesn't seem to be working properly is the ping command. Open a Command Prompt window from your Start menu and run a command like ping google.com or ping howtogeek.com . Press the Windows + X key and click on Device Manager to update a driver. The Device Manager dialog box will open. Here, expand Network Adapter and right-click and update all the drivers inside it. Restart your computer you update all the drivers. Spectrum offers a variety of plans, each with its own unique set of benefits and ...Jun 17, 2020 · Sometimes, the link between your local network (managed by a router, hub, or modem) and the internet goes down. There could be a temporary problem with your ISP's equipment, physical damage to cables that link you to the ISP's network, or some other issue. In that case, you are still connected to the local network, but your local network is not ...
